The house we bought came with solar. It’s a 10 kW system and our utility offers “credit” so they act like storage/battery.

In December, which is probably our heaviest electrical usage month (winter is dark and cold.) we used 1.6 MW, but we make about 75% of what we use.

This chart shows the annual production of solar by month over the last years. There’s a data gap in March/April 2020 because that’s when the house was bought.

Summer is when we bank all the energy for winter. Would be impossible with “real” batteries.

Highest usage in the summer was about 1600 kWh
Lowest usage in the winter was about 900 kWh

Air conditioning is definitely the biggest drain on electricity for us. But we also have two people working from home sucking up a lot of electricity as well.

I'm in Minnesota for reference. Newer energy efficient ~ 2500 square foot house with a family of five.

Natural gas is the opposite as we need to heat in the winter.

Highest usage in the winter was about 200 therms
Lowest usage in the summer was about 20 therms

I didn't realize how much more the cost of gas was last year as my bill is auto pay. Usually about $150-200 per month in the cold months, but last year it was twice that.
